It's a epoch date (seconds from 1/1/70). DateTime has conversion methods exposed. Check the API in The Zope Book.
On Fri, 5 Mar 2004, Ed Colmar wrote:
I'm sure this has been asked before, but I couldn't get any search hits. Hopefully someone could point me in the right direction.
I have a date field that looks like 1076754860
How can I convert this out to a regular date?
